Transaction 7631e2830722be6ccdf9e56bcede4af693eac7a40878b9b7c8adc7627b87846a
1 Input
2 Outputs
- 7631e2830722be6ccdf9e56bcede4af693eac7a40878b9b7c8adc7627b87846a:0
- 7631e2830722be6ccdf9e56bcede4af693eac7a40878b9b7c8adc7627b87846a:1
value 352432
address 3CYFSa96CF1XtwSw46rpTYDH6JmFJVSyFd
value 170793313
address 19wqPxc5zWYs8wm6Z8qYhtJWquBcmMUWph